YIW 2781 is a 2000 Suzuki Alto in Yellow with a 993c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 2000 Suzuki Alto models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.8% with a typical mileage of 46,196 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Suzuki Alto f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 33,718 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YIW 2781,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ki Alto typ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 26 years old, this Suzuki Alto is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
